1. Understanding the Importance of Fuel Filter Changes in TDIs
Diesel engines, particularly those with TDI (Turbocharged Direct Injection) technology, rely on clean fuel for optimal performance and longevity. The fuel filter plays a crucial role in removing contaminants like dirt, rust, and sediment from the fuel before it reaches the sensitive components of the fuel injection system. Over time, the fuel filter becomes clogged, reducing fuel flow and potentially causing various engine problems.
-
Reduced Engine Performance: A clogged fuel filter restricts fuel flow, leading to decreased engine power, acceleration, and overall performance.
-
Poor Fuel Economy: Insufficient fuel supply can cause the engine to work harder, resulting in reduced fuel efficiency and increased fuel consumption.
-
Engine Starting Problems: A severely clogged fuel filter can make it difficult to start the engine, especially in cold weather conditions.
-
Damage to Fuel Injection System: Contaminants that bypass a clogged fuel filter can damage the injectors and high-pressure fuel pump, leading to costly repairs.
-
Black Smoke Emission: Incomplete combustion due to restricted fuel flow can cause excessive black smoke emission from the exhaust.
-
Rough Idling: A dirty fuel filter can cause the engine to idle unevenly or roughly.
Therefore, regular fuel filter changes are essential for maintaining the health and performance of your TDI engine.
2. Why VCDS is Typically Recommended for TDI Fuel Filter Changes
VCDS (VAG-COM Diagnostic System) is a diagnostic tool widely used for Volkswagen, Audi, Skoda, and SEAT vehicles. It allows technicians and enthusiasts to access and modify various vehicle settings, including priming the fuel system after a fuel filter change. Priming the fuel system involves running the fuel pump to purge air from the system and ensure a smooth flow of fuel to the engine.
-
Ensuring Proper Fuel System Priming: VCDS allows users to activate the fuel pump and prime the fuel system after replacing the fuel filter, which is crucial for removing air bubbles and ensuring proper fuel delivery to the engine.
-
Preventing Engine Starting Issues: By using VCDS to prime the fuel system, you can avoid potential engine starting problems caused by airlocks or insufficient fuel pressure.
-
Protecting the High-Pressure Fuel Pump (HPFP): Priming the fuel system helps prevent damage to the HPFP by ensuring it receives a steady supply of fuel, reducing the risk of cavitation or dry running.

4. Step-by-Step Guide: Performing a TDI Fuel Filter Change Without VCDS
While VCDS offers a convenient way to prime the fuel system, you can still perform a TDI fuel filter change without it. Here’s a detailed step-by-step guide:
Step 1: Gather Necessary Tools and Materials:
- New fuel filter (ensure it’s the correct type for your vehicle)
- Wrench or socket set
- Screwdrivers (flathead and Phillips head)
- Pliers
- Fuel line disconnect tool (if applicable)
- Clean rags or shop towels
- Fuel container to catch spills
- Gloves
- Safety glasses
Step 2: Prepare the Vehicle:
- Park the vehicle on a level surface and engage the parking brake.
- Allow the engine to cool down completely.
- Disconnect the negative battery terminal to prevent accidental electrical shorts.
Step 3: Locate the Fuel Filter:
- The fuel filter is typically located in the engine compartment, near the fuel tank, or along the fuel lines.
- Consult your vehicle’s service manual or online resources to identify the exact location of the fuel filter.
Step 4: Relieve Fuel System Pressure (if applicable):
- Some TDI models may require you to relieve fuel system pressure before disconnecting the fuel lines.
- Consult your vehicle’s service manual for the proper procedure to relieve fuel pressure. This may involve disconnecting the fuel pump relay or using a specialized tool.
Step 5: Disconnect Fuel Lines:
- Carefully disconnect the fuel lines from the fuel filter.
- Use a fuel line disconnect tool if necessary.
- Be prepared to catch any fuel spills with a container and rags.
- Note the orientation of the fuel lines for proper reconnection.
Step 6: Remove the Old Fuel Filter:
- Loosen any clamps or fasteners securing the fuel filter.
- Carefully remove the old fuel filter from its housing or bracket.
Step 7: Prepare the New Fuel Filter:
- Inspect the new fuel filter for any damage or defects.
- If the new fuel filter comes with O-rings or seals, make sure they are properly installed.
- Some fuel filters may require you to pre-fill them with fuel before installation. Consult the manufacturer’s instructions.
Step 8: Install the New Fuel Filter:
- Carefully install the new fuel filter into its housing or bracket.
- Ensure it is properly seated and aligned.
- Tighten any clamps or fasteners to secure the fuel filter.
Step 9: Reconnect Fuel Lines:
- Reconnect the fuel lines to the fuel filter, ensuring they are properly oriented.
- Use new clamps if necessary.
- Make sure the fuel lines are securely connected to prevent leaks.
Step 10: Prime the Fuel System (Without VCDS):
This is the most critical step when performing a fuel filter change without VCDS. Here are a few methods you can try:
-
Method 1: Key Cycling:
- Turn the ignition key to the “ON” position (without starting the engine) for 2-3 minutes. This will activate the fuel pump and allow it to prime the system.
- Repeat this process several times.
- Attempt to start the engine. It may take a few tries, and the engine may run rough initially.
- Allow the engine to idle for a few minutes to purge any remaining air from the system.
-
Method 2: Manual Fuel Pump Activation:
- Locate the fuel pump relay in the fuse box.
- Remove the relay.
- Use a jumper wire to connect the appropriate terminals in the relay socket to manually activate the fuel pump. Consult your vehicle’s service manual for the correct terminals.
- Run the fuel pump for 2-3 minutes to prime the system.
- Remove the jumper wire and reinstall the fuel pump relay.
- Attempt to start the engine.
-
Method 3: Cranking the Engine:
- This method should be used as a last resort, as excessive cranking can be hard on the starter motor.
- Crank the engine for 10-15 seconds at a time, with short breaks in between.
- Repeat this process until the engine starts.
- Be prepared for the engine to run rough initially.
Step 11: Check for Leaks:
- After starting the engine, carefully inspect the fuel filter and fuel lines for any leaks.
- Tighten any connections if necessary.
Step 12: Reconnect the Battery:
- Reconnect the negative battery terminal.
Step 13: Test Drive the Vehicle:
- Take the vehicle for a test drive to ensure the engine is running smoothly and there are no fuel-related issues.

6. Potential Risks and Challenges of Changing a TDI Fuel Filter Without VCDS
While it’s possible to change a TDI fuel filter without VCDS, it’s important to be aware of the potential risks and challenges involved.
-
Difficulty Priming the Fuel System: Without VCDS, priming the fuel system can be more challenging and may require multiple attempts or alternative techniques.
-
Engine Starting Problems: If the fuel system is not properly primed, it can lead to engine starting problems, rough idling, or even stalling.
-
Damage to High-Pressure Fuel Pump (HPFP): Running the HPFP without adequate fuel supply can cause damage due to cavitation or dry running.
-
Increased Strain on Starter Motor: Excessive cranking to start the engine can put extra strain on the starter motor, potentially shortening its lifespan.
-
Diagnostic Limitations: Without VCDS, you won’t be able to diagnose any underlying issues with the fuel system or engine that may be contributing to the problem.

10. Troubleshooting Common Issues After a TDI Fuel Filter Change Without VCDS
Even with careful execution, you may encounter some common issues after a TDI fuel filter change without VCDS. Here’s how to troubleshoot them:
-
Engine Won’t Start:
- Possible Cause: Air in the fuel system.
- Troubleshooting: Repeat priming procedures, check fuel lines for leaks, ensure fuel pump is functioning.
-
Rough Idling:
- Possible Cause: Air in the fuel system, incorrect fuel filter installation.
- Troubleshooting: Allow engine to run and purge air, re-check filter installation.
-
Reduced Engine Power:
- Possible Cause: Restricted fuel flow, incorrect fuel filter.
- Troubleshooting: Check for fuel line obstructions, verify correct fuel filter model.
-
Fuel Leaks:
- Possible Cause: Improperly connected fuel lines, damaged O-rings or seals.
- Troubleshooting: Tighten connections, replace O-rings, ensure proper seal.
-
Check Engine Light:
- Possible Cause: Fuel system issues, sensor malfunction.
- Troubleshooting: Use an OBD-II scanner to read codes, address identified issues.
11. How Often Should You Change Your TDI Fuel Filter?
The frequency of fuel filter changes depends on various factors, including driving conditions, fuel quality, and manufacturer recommendations. However, as a general guideline:
- Recommended Interval: Change your TDI fuel filter every 20,000 to 40,000 miles or every two years, whichever comes first.
- Driving Conditions: If you frequently drive in dusty or off-road conditions, you may need to change the fuel filter more often.
- Fuel Quality: Poor fuel quality can clog the fuel filter more quickly, requiring more frequent changes.
- Manufacturer Recommendations: Consult your vehicle’s service manual for specific recommendations from the manufacturer.
Factor | Recommendation |
---|---|
Normal Driving | 20,000 – 40,000 miles or every 2 years |
Dusty Conditions | More frequent changes, possibly every 15,000 – 25,000 miles |
Poor Fuel Quality | More frequent changes, inspect filter regularly |
Manufacturer Guidance | Refer to the vehicle’s service manual for specific instructions |
